在使用v2ray的过程中,用户可能会遇到提示 未找到v2ray文件 的情况。这一问题常常令人困扰,尤其是对于初学者而言。本文将详细分析该问题的可能原因,并提供合理的解决方案。
什么是v2ray?
v2ray是一个核心工具,通过不同的协议实现科学上网,它可以用于翻墙、乃至科学上网解决方案。v2ray相较于其他工具(如Shadowsocks)更为灵活,可支持多种传输方式及实现策略。
未找到v2ray文件的原因
在尝试启动或使用v2ray时,如果出现“未找到 v2ray 文件”的报错,可能原因包括:
-
文件路径错误
- 程序在运行时,指定的文件路径未找到,缺少了关键的文件。
-
v2ray未正确安装
- 如果v2ray未完整安装,或者中途遭遇了意外中断,可能会导致某些文件缺失。
-
权限问题
- 当系统权限不足以访问指定目录或文件时,可能也会导致该错误。
-
操作系统兼容性
- v2ray不同版本可能对不同操作系统有兼容性问题,如果使用了不对的版本,也可能导致无法找到相应的文件。
如何解决未找到v2ray文件的问题
出现“未找到v2ray文件”的提示后,建议按照以下步骤进行排查和解决:
1. 检查文件路径
确认运行命令时提供的文件路径是否正确。手动导航到该目录确认v2ray文件是否真实存在。
2. 更新或重新安装v2ray
如果确认文件确实缺失,可以选择重新安装v2ray,确保完整获取所有必要的文件。可参考以下步骤:
- 前往 v2ray 官网,下载最新版本。
- 解压下载的文件包至您选择的目录。
- 执行初始化脚本完成安装。
3. 修改文件权限
确保程序所需文件的读写权限设置合适:
- 在控制台输入
chmod +x path_to_v2ray
(替换path_to_v2ray
为具体的文件路径)为file设置可执行权限。
4. 确保系统环境兼容
v2ray的版本很大程度上依赖于操作系统和环境。可参考官网提供的指导,下载匹配版。不同的操作系统(如Windows、Linux、Mac)下可能需要特定的二进制文件。
未找到v2ray文件的一些常见问题
为了进一步对未找到v2ray文件隐藏问题的理解,以下常见问题可以帮助到您:
Q: 如何检查我的v2ray版本是否适合我的操作系统?
A: 可以在v2ray 的GitHub主页上找到对应版本的信息及操作系统要求。
Q: 如果在安装时网络不稳定,如何确保v2ray安装完整?
A: 支持直接下载源码,然后在本地进行构建。此外,使用工具(如wget)进行无干扰下载,可以提高成功概率。
Q: 找不到v2ray文件的情况下,我如何进行排除了安装搁置、掌握目录的问题后?
A: 检查 logs 或 logs 目录的内容来帮助排除和发现其他软件或配置的问题,特别是在自定义配置的情况下。
Q: 如何优雅关闭 v2ray 服务?
A: 如果需要停止v2ray,可以使用 systemctl stop v2ray
(Systemd 配置)。确保一些临时运行时权限具备,让服务谨慎优雅的退出,并不会一直占据系统资源。
总结
综上,未找到v2ray文件通常是由于不正确的安装、权限或系统不兼容引起的。通过本文提供的步骤和说明,用户可以迅速定位并解决此类问题。如果依旧存在困难,请前往社区论坛询问更多帮助。